#9e0d9f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9e0d9f is composed of 62% red, 5.1%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.6% cyan, 91.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 299.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 33.7%. #9e0d9f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aff with #3d003f.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#9e0d9f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e010e is the darkest color, while #fffb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e0d9f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565656 is the less saturated color, while #a506a6 is the most saturated one.
